Constance H. Gemson currently creates and conducts educational workshops on resiliency, coping with change, and managing stress. She continues to be an active member of the Professional Staff Congress. Her work has been published inNarrative in Social Work Practice: The Power and Possibility of Story. and other books. Her play Cigarette Girl in the South Bronx was produced by the Working Theater. Constance is writing a memoir about her New York City life.
